In a coordinated effort to fortify global industrial infrastructure, Schneider Electric, Siemens, and Aveva have published their September 2026 Patch Tuesday advisories. These updates address a range of vulnerabilities within Industrial Control Systems (ICS) that, if left unpatched, could provide attackers with a gateway into critical manufacturing and energy networks.

Schneider Electric released four new security advisories, the most alarming being a critical authentication vulnerability in Modicon M580 and Modicon M580 Safety controllers. Tracked as CVE-2026-3869, this flaw carries a staggering CVSS score of 9.2, indicating a high ease of exploitation and severe impact. Additionally, the company resolved high-severity bugs in the PowerLogic T300 platform and EcoStruxure IT Data Center Expert.

Siemens has been equally active, publishing nine new advisories. Critical-severity vulnerabilities were identified in Reyrolle 7SR5, Open Interface Services (OIS), and SIMOVE Fleetmanager. Furthermore, Siemens addressed the 'Copy Fail' Linux kernel vulnerability (CVE-2026-31431), which could allow a sophisticated attacker to gain root shell access, effectively taking full control of the affected system.

Why This Matters

BozokMedia analysis shows that the convergence of IT and OT (Operational Technology) has expanded the attack surface for industrial plants. Unlike standard IT systems, patching an ICS often requires scheduled downtime, creating a 'window of vulnerability' that state-sponsored actors frequently exploit to target critical infrastructure.

Aveva focused its updates on the PIMBoards component of its Pipeline Integrity Monitor. The advisory highlighted two high-severity bugs: the use of a hardcoded encryption key and the use of MD5 hashing for passwords. Both flaws would allow a determined attacker to decrypt sensitive data or reverse-engineer administrative credentials.

Adding to the urgency, Rockwell Automation published nine advisories covering critical flaws in RSLinx Classic and various CompactLogix and GuardLogix controllers. Simultaneously, CISA (Cybersecurity and Infrastructure Security Agency) issued warnings for a wide array of products from vendors like Hitachi Energy and Johnson Controls, underscoring a systemic vulnerability trend across the sector.

Frequently Asked Questions

Q1: What is an ICS Patch Tuesday?
It is a periodic release of security updates by industrial vendors to fix vulnerabilities in hardware and software used to control industrial processes.

Q2: Why are these patches more critical than standard software updates?
Because ICS products control physical machinery; a breach can lead to physical damage, environmental disasters, or loss of life, unlike a typical data breach.
